The only reason to use a tool like this, given the context of its name and distribution, is for malicious activity. It is a key component of a attack.
Using automated "account checker" software has significant legal and ethical dimensions. These tools are designed to identify and exploit compromised accounts without the account owner's knowledge. This activity violates Netflix's Terms of Service and constitutes a form of unauthorized access, which is illegal in most jurisdictions under laws like the Computer Fraud and Abuse Act (CFAA) in the U.S. or similar legislation globally. "NetFlix Account Checker ProxyLess V1.0" is a credential testing tool typically found on cracking forums and file-sharing sites. Marketed under the "PiratePC" brand, it claims to test lists of username and password combinations against Netflix’s servers to identify working accounts without the need for a proxy list.
